If its just the one side, there is either a wiring issue, a problem with the mirror motor or a door module problem. There is most likley a "B" code stored that would help in the diagnostics, but, without the correct scanner you will not be able read the code.

owners with these do have problems like this. they switched to the manual type. lots of failures with this option .
since the driverside controls work it is most likely the passsengerside mirror motor.
expensive . about 300.oo ea.
I use 30wt air compressor oil with some powered grafite mixed in , to lube the door hinges/latches. use a small acid brush to coat the surface.
